The Super Falcons stunned the world by recovering from a 2-0 deficit to defeat Morocco 3-2 in Rabat.
Esther Okoronkwo’s penalty in the 64th minute sparked hope, Flourish Ijamilusi equalized in the 71st, and Jennifer Echegini sealed the win in the 88th minute.
The Super Falcons Victory earned them a record 10th WAFCON title, cementing their place at the summit of African women’s football.
